Hunterdon CountyHazard Mitigation Plan Update
Meeting Minutes
1 of 1
Purpose of Meeting: Steering Committee Meeting #4
Location of Meeting: Conference Call
Date of Meeting:May 17, 2016
Attendees:
Agenda Summary: This meeting was held to address the below topics discussed with the Steering Committee.
ItemNo.
Description Action By:
1 Status of Plan Update – Remaining infomration needed fromHampton Borough and Lebanon Township.
Tetra Tech
2 Discuss Citizen and Stakeholder draft HMP comments - The 30 daypublic review period has concluded. There were no responses fromthe public received via the County website’s comment capture tool. Aletter was received from the Highlands Council. The SteeringCommittee decided to incorporate the reference to NJDEP’s toolkitinto the capability assessment presented in Section 6.
Tetra Tech to revise Section 6to include informationprovided by the HighlandsCouncil.
3 Discuss citizen survey and stakeholder survey responses – Asummary of the survey responses was distributed to the committeeand all plan participants. Brayden will follow up with Social Services toobtain clarification on their comment regarding a secondary location;may not require a change to the plan.
Brayden Fahey (HC OEM)
4 Enhanced severe repetitive loss strategy - The Steering Committeeagreed to include text regarding the outreach conducted, datagathered, and FEMA grant application submitted in their county annexand Section 6.
Tetra Tech to revise thecounty annex (Section 9.1)and Section 6to include theenhanced SRL strategyprocess; distribute back tothe Steering Committee
5 HMP Submittal – Plan being printed and submitted the week of May23rd.
Tetra Tech
6 Adoptions – When FEMA approval pending adoption is received, thecounty should get the HMP adoption on the next Freeholder meetingagenda to formally adopt the plan via resolution. Templateresolutions will be distributed to all municipalities to formally adopt aswell.
Tetra Tech
